The technology has changed tremendously since its inception in 1995. In the medical field, a used C Arm for sale can go a long way. The imaging systems are used often in orthopedics, surgery, vascular cardiology and surgery, traumatology, and other surgical imaging needs. Medical professionals can always protect their bottom line by purchasing used imaging devices.

There are many reasons to buy refurbished arms. Typically, medical equipment use is expensive, and most medical practices ensure that their machines are in excellent shape and well maintained. Many C-Arms are durable, robust, and sturdy. Most are in excellent work condition and can be purchased for a fraction of the price of newer and unused models.

No matter what medical field you work in, it is essential to choose your investments wisely. A C-Arm is a good investment. They are noninvasive and provide a comfortable environment. Mobile arms contribute to operating room precision, image quality, operability, versatility, and efficiency. The arms are used for x-ray imaging in most healthcare facilities.

The machines are perfect in time sensitive and complex procedures of medical treatment. Not all equipment are the same, and the efficiency, usability, and safety of operating rooms should be observed under careful evaluation. Most modern machines are smaller than the traditional models. In mobile applications, the smaller the machine the easier to is to use them in emergencies.

The machines magnify images through intensifiers. The intensifiers makes it where there are few X-rays exposing radiation. The modern machines are less inclined to exposing radiation. Doctors and patients can rest easy knowing that radiation exposure is minimal. The newer models can be fine-tuned to the environment for which they are used. This means that doctors can minimize radiation exposure.

The C-Arm is a big investment. Shopping for the right model and make is just as challenging. If you purchase an exact machine that offers only the features that you need, you are doing well. There are three factors to keep in mind. Determine who will be using the system and why they will be using it. Estimate how many times the system will be used. Ensure that your use of the system provides a greater return on investment.

The C-Arm needs to meet all specifications in a medical field. The right makes and model will determine if it will meet specifications. Buying an overpowered machine is just as costly as buying a subpar performance machine. The specifications of surgical procedures should be accommodated by the equipment. For instance, in orthopedics, the orthodontist would benefit from using a mini machine that does the fundamentals rather than equipment with too many unpractical features.

Doctors use the systems for pain management and trauma patients. Different medical practices have unique specifications, and the system you should accommodate those differences. The maximum geometric range of the x-ray machine is quite important. Other aspects that should be considered are memory capacity and compatible printers.
